Context Memecoins are the purest form of speculative chaos. No fundamentals, no roadmap, just hype and liquidity. But where there is leverage, there is order—an order imposed by liquidation engines. Platforms like GMX, dYdX, and SynFutures allow users to long or short tokens with up to 50x leverage. When price moves against a position, the protocol forcibly closes it, and the liquidator often profits from the remaining margin. The victim is emotional, the hunter is algorithmic.
Core: The Mechanism of Extraction Let's deconstruct the address's behavior. Over 72 hours, it executed a series of trades that triggered 498 liquidations. The total profit: $12.7 million. The initial capital: $152,000. That's a return of 83x, but the narrative is more nuanced.
Using on-chain forensics, I traced the address's pattern. It would open a large position—typically a long—on a low-liquidity memecoin, then use a second wallet to create a short of similar size. As the price oscillated, one side would get liquidated, but the hunter had already placed stop-losses or used the other wallet's profit to absorb the loss. The key was timing: by monitoring the mempool and calculating the exact liquidation price, the address could anticipate programmatic close-outs.
This is not gambling; it's engineering. The hunter exploited the fact that liquidations in memecoin pairs are often executed by bots, but the underlying price oracle (typically Chainlink or a DEX spot price) lags behind the actual market depth. By front-running the oracle update with a market order, the address could force a liquidation before the price reached equilibrium. The 498 liquidations represent 498 individual victims—retail traders who thought they were catching a trend but became liquidity for a machine.

Contrarian: The Myth of the Retail Hero Mainstream media would frame this as a 'memecoin millionaire' story. But the contrarian view is that this is a structural failure of DeFi risk management. The address didn't outsmart the market; it outsmarted the protocol's design. The real blind spot is that liquidation mechanics are designed for high-liquidity assets, not memecoins. On a token with $2 million in liquidity, a $500,000 order can move price by 10%, triggering a cascade. The hunter simply used capital asymmetry to force a cascade.

Moreover, the narrative that 'anyone can do this' is dangerous. Based on my experience auditing DeFi protocols during the 2020 DeFi summer, I've seen this pattern before—it's called 'liquidation dominance.' The address's wallet likely had pre-existing relationships with market makers or used flash loans to amplify its initial capital. The average retail trader cannot replicate this without a team of programmers and a private mempool connection.
